Is Python good for accounting?

From an accountancy perspective, Python is most useful when working with data. It can essentially read any type, both structured and unstructured. It has powerful capabilities in data importation and manipulation – tasks like merging and recoding – as well as handling large amounts.

What is SAP accounting software?

SAPs Accounting software provides you with a way of managing your business accounts including journal entries, accounts receivable and accounts payable, as well as accurately tracking cash flow, fixed assets and monitoring performance against budgets.

What course is accountant?

The Bachelor of Science in Accountancy (BSA) program is a five-year program focused on subjects in financial, public, and managerial accounting, auditing, administration, business laws, and taxation.

Business Administration

With a double major in business administration, you can delve deeper into the world of ethics, law, marketing, and even communication that all businesses thrive on. With this credential, employers will trust your vision, judgment, and accuracy with accounting skills.

Computer Information Systems

A computer information systems double major will complement an accounting degree because almost all businesses inherently exist on the internet and need some form of monitoring and maintenance of their framework. Technology is an ever-expanding field that will need oversight and accurate financial projections in all sectors.

Economics

An economics double major will complement an accounting degree smoothly because you will learn how to use reason and logic to identify and resolve complex issues. This can be found in any business as they all rely on financial data to create a plan for the future.
